Output 14bb1a66539d150b13033dba5c6a642c5899439c675204a14fb5f7e1de422757:1

value
32547166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ab8c13edb4c436f95851c43b0e664eb9a9f5ca63 OP_EQUAL
address
3HL5H8GVnTDNwQ46DSkPcHtUVcpnBp53CH
transaction
14bb1a66539d150b13033dba5c6a642c5899439c675204a14fb5f7e1de422757
spent
true